| FIBC Bulk Bag | Woven polypropylene body with lifting loops; optional liner and coated fabric | Dry powders, granules, resin, fertilizers, pigments, and non-hazardous mineral chemicals | 500–2,000 kg | Good with a sealed polyethylene liner or coated fabric; standard woven fabric alone is not fully moisture-proof | Good for dry solids Confirm compatibility with the liner and product formulation. | Required when used for regulated dangerous goods; verify the exact UN design, packing group, and testing documentation | Usually single-trip for regulated materials; reusable only when the design, inspection, and cleaning program allow it | Check safe working load, safety factor, discharge design, liner fit, seam strength, and traceability |
| PE Lined Woven Bag | Polypropylene woven outer layer with an inner polyethylene liner | Fine powders, hygroscopic chemicals, salts, detergents, and dry additives | 10–50 kg | High Liner thickness and closure method strongly affect protection. | Broad dry-solid use Test against oxidizers, solvents, and concentrated chemicals before approval. | Use only a certified design when the filled bag is classified as dangerous goods | Generally intended for one-way shipment | Request liner specifications, heat-seal performance, drop-test results, and batch consistency data |
| Multiwall Paper Chemical Sack | Two or more kraft-paper plies, often with a polyethylene film or laminated barrier | Dry powders, cementitious chemicals, mineral powders, and selected industrial additives | 10–25 kg | Moderate to high A polyethylene barrier improves resistance to humidity and dust leakage. | Product-specific Not suitable for all corrosive, wet, or solvent-based chemicals. | Confirm whether the sack design is approved for the intended dangerous-goods classification | Normally single-use | Evaluate burst strength, paper ply quality, valve performance, pallet stability, and dust control |
| HDPE Woven Hazardous-Goods Bag | High-density polyethylene woven fabric with reinforced seams and optional liner | Selected corrosive powders, industrial minerals, fertilizers, and hazardous dry solids | 25–1,000 kg | High with liner | Good for many dry chemicals Compatibility must be verified using concentration, temperature, and exposure-time data. | Look for a valid UN specification marking and test report matching the intended contents | Usually single-trip for dangerous goods | Verify material identification, seam integrity, closure system, drop testing, and certificate validity |
| Conductive or Antistatic FIBC | Woven polypropylene with conductive yarns or antistatic construction | Flammable powders, combustible dusts, and chemicals handled in potentially explosive atmospheres | 500–2,000 kg | Depends on fabric coating and liner; a conductive liner may be required | Depends on liner | UN approval does not replace electrical safety assessment or correct grounding procedures | Typically controlled single-trip use for hazardous materials | Confirm FIBC type, grounding requirements, surface resistance, ignition-risk assessment, and operator procedures |
| Flexible Intermediate Bulk Container with Form-Fit Liner | FIBC outer body with a shaped polyethylene liner designed to reduce residual product | Fine powders, moisture-sensitive chemicals, pharmaceuticals, and high-purity industrial materials | 500–1,500 kg | Very high Reduced folds can improve emptying and minimize product retention. | Suitable for many dry powders Request a written compatibility assessment for aggressive chemicals. | Certification must cover the complete bag-and-liner configuration, not only the outer body | Usually single-use unless specifically designed and approved otherwise | Check liner dimensional accuracy, filling and discharge fit, cleanliness controls, and product recovery rate |
| Small Plastic Chemical Sack | Polyethylene or polypropylene film, optionally laminated or co-extruded | Small-volume powders, pellets, laboratory materials, and secondary packaging | 1–25 kg | Moderate to high Film thickness and seal quality determine leakage resistance. | Limited by film type Do not assume general-purpose polyethylene is compatible with every chemical. | Required when the package is used as approved dangerous-goods packaging | Normally single-use | Review film thickness, tensile strength, seal integrity, puncture resistance, and closure quality |
| Fluoropolymer-Lined Bag | Industrial outer bag combined with a fluoropolymer film or lining for demanding chemical service | Aggressive chemicals, high-purity powders, and applications requiring stronger chemical resistance | 5–500 kg | High | High, but application-specific Confirm resistance to the exact chemical, concentration, temperature, and contact duration. | Confirm that the full package has the required certification and transport approvals | Usually single-use unless cleaning and inspection are formally validated | Request lining material data, extractables information, seam design, chemical test results, and lot traceability |
